Abstract
The statistics on demand of customer is very important for business, such as collecting location information of customers to provide them with various services. In this paper, we present a new method for customers to authenticate their identity and position without revealing them and statistics the distribution of passenger flow in different periods, where the purpose of privacy-preserving could be achieved. Due to the identify of customers changes rapidly, in order to ensure that the identify of customers can be updated in time, this paper use dynamic group signature method to add and delete identify frequently. In the meantime, customers need to be divided into different types to meet the needs of different business. Therefore, we will use customers' age and occupation as their identify marks. In order to understand the needs of customers of different ID, age and occupations that we statistics the identity to help business find the suitable development areas.
